> This allows to reuse the helper also with MigrationIncomingState.

I get the point, but just to mention that this helper doesn't really change
much on incoming side on simplifying the code or function-wise, because we
don't have CANCELLING/CANCELLED state on deste QEMU.. which is definitely
not obvious.. :(

So:

  migration_has_failed(incoming->state)

Is exactly the same as:

  incoming->state == MIGRATION_STATUS_FAILED

Except it will make src start to pass in s->state.. which is slightly more
awkward.

Maybe we keep the MIGRATION_STATUS_FAILED check in your next patch, and
drop this one for now until it grows more than FAILED on dest?
